Output 2714bd8061b7fbc6a3d6be376d79d9c850ae95881a5a0a9c6c2d1d0e9f3da4de:0

value
12091136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8840e51872aba345116e812ca2c4678e40b33c5 OP_EQUAL
address
3MRr5PM6oLkCDcNiysvA6PAxXzgjbRcrT3
transaction
2714bd8061b7fbc6a3d6be376d79d9c850ae95881a5a0a9c6c2d1d0e9f3da4de
confirmations
293915
spent
true